Communications Markets in Indonesia
Pyramid Research, Inc., May 2003, Pages: 20
Political and economic instability continues to plague Indonesia. Upcoming elections in 2004 are shaping policy decisions, and specifically, we have seen the government go back on its previous promise to increase fixed tariffs. This has caused a scale-back in planned fixed-line investment. The mobile sector will see more competition and investment this year, albeit at the cost of fixed-line expansion.
This 20-page report takes a comprehensive look at the Indonesian market, covering immediate issues facing the market, in the context of the political, economic, regulatory, and competitive environments. It includes fixed communications predictions, mobile communications predictions, vendor relationships, and risk assessment.
